The Itinerary Breakdown
The tour kicks off at 8:30 am, giving you the chance to experience the churches during their quieter morning hours—a significant advantage, especially since Lalibela can get busy. The first stop features the group of rock-hewn churches, including Bete Medhane Alem, the largest with five aisles and over 70 pillars, showcasing an impressive vaulted dome and detailed molding. This site’s size and architectural complexity are staggering, and it’s a clear highlight for first-time visitors.
Bete Mariam, known for its intricate decorations, tends to draw praise for its beauty. Moving Beyond the First Cluster
After a hearty lunch around 2 pm, the tour continues to explore Bet Gabriel-Rufael, Bet Merkorios, Bet Amanual, and Bet Abba Libanos. These additional churches, often less crowded, offer a more intimate experience. You’ll get to walk through deep underground tunnels, which connect many of the structures. These tunnels are one of the tour’s most memorable features—narrow, cool, and slightly mysterious, they give a real sense of how the churches were built into the volcanic landscape.
